Jewell Island Fall Camping Trip

The tides are not as ideal for a morning put in, so we're thinking lunchtime put-in will have us paddling the last of flow and into slack and ebb. On the Sunday return from Jewell, a late morning put in will allow us to ride the tide back to Cousins Island.

The plan for the four day trip is as follows:

Here’s our thoughts:

Thursday 9/20 (High Tide @ 2:47pm): Group #1 beach briefing around 12or 1pm, launch from Sandy Point on Cousins Island to an interim island such as Bangs or Crow for snack/lunch (we can discuss stewardship if there is interest) and then continue on to Jewell.

Friday 9/21 (High Tide @ 3:43pm): Group #2 (same as above). Group #1 is open for a local paddle or relaxing and exploring Jewell Island. Our thought is that a designated contact from Group #1 will keep in touch with a designated contact in Group #2 via cell phone or radio.

Saturday 9/22: Day is open for a local paddle or relaxing and exploring Jewell island.

Sunday 9/23 (High Tide @ 11:30am): Return to mainland, mid-morning launch around 11 or so.
